Jalousie window replacement services involve removing old, worn-out jalousie windows and installing new units that enhance both function and appearance. This process typically includes carefully removing the existing window frames, inspecting the surrounding structure, and fitting the new windows to ensure proper operation. Service providers may also handle any necessary repairs to window openings or framing to make sure the new jalousie windows fit securely and work smoothly. Homeowners seeking this service often look for a solution that improves ventilation, natural light, and overall home comfort.
Many problems can be addressed through jalousie window replacement. Older units may become difficult to open or close, or the glass panes might become foggy or cracked over time. These issues can compromise energy efficiency by allowing drafts or heat transfer, leading to increased utility costs. Additionally, damaged or malfunctioning jalousie windows can pose security concerns or reduce the effectiveness of insect screens. Replacing these windows helps resolve these issues, restoring proper airflow, visibility, and security to the property.

The overview below groups typical Jalousie Window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Boise, ID.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- For minor jalousie window repairs or part replacements, local contractors typically charge between $150 and $400. Most routine fixes fall within this range, depending on the extent of the work needed.
Partial Replacement - Replacing a few jalousie window panels or hardware usually costs between $600 and $1,200. Many projects in this category are straightforward and stay within this mid-tier cost range.
Full Window Replacement - A complete replacement of a standard jalousie window often ranges from $1,200 to $3,000, with larger or more complex installations potentially reaching higher costs. Most full replacements fall into this range, depending on window size and material choices.
Custom or Large-Scale Projects - Larger or custom jalousie window installations can exceed $5,000, especially if multiple windows or intricate design features are involved. These projects are less common but can represent the upper end of typical costs for specialized work.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
